How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Outer Seaport?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Outer Seaport Studio Apartments | $1,356 | $620 | $1,649 |
| Outer Seaport 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,282 | $650 | $2,216 |
| Outer Seaport 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,193 | $770 | $3,208 |
| Outer Seaport 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,272 | $880 | $3,673 |
| Outer Seaport 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,499 | $4,499 | $4,499 |
